Research Notes

I have been unable to find any certain sources for John Farmer and/or his wife Susannah Cheatham. I also question the validity of the marriage record cited showing they married in 1712 in South Carolina. There is no evidence they ever left Virginia. Shirley Dalton 16:25, 20 June 2020 (UTC)
